Tự động hóa quá trình áp dụng các điều chỉnh cân bằng màu cho các tệp ảnh PSD có thể cải thiện đáng kể hiệu quả của các nhóm tiếp thị, xuất bản, hoặc thương mại điện tử. Với Aspose.PSD cho .NET, các nhà phát triển dễ dàng tích hợp các khả năng xử lý hình ảnh tiên tiến vào các ứng dụng của họ, đảm bảo rằng các bức ảnh được chỉnh sửa một cách nhất quán và chính xác mà không cần can thiệp thủ công. Bài viết blog này sẽ hướng dẫn bạn thông qua quy trình tự động hoá việc sửa chữa cân nặng màu bằng cách sử dụng Asposa. PSD, cung cấp một bước thực hiện và các ví dụ thực tế.

Một ví dụ đầy đủ

Để chứng minh làm thế nào để tự động điều chỉnh cân bằng màu trong các tệp PSD, chúng tôi sẽ đi qua một ví dụ đầy đủ cho thấy các bước quan trọng liên quan. Ví dụ này sẽ bao gồm việc tải một tập tin PSD, áp dụng các tùy chọn cân nặng màu, và tiết kiệm hình ảnh được sửa đổi trở lại ổ đĩa.

Hướng dẫn Step-by-Step

Bước 1: Tải tập tin PSD

Bước đầu tiên là tải tệp PSD vào ứng dụng của bạn bằng cách sử dụng Aspose.PSD. Điều này liên quan đến việc khởi động một ví dụ về Image lớp và xác định con đường đến tệp PSD mà bạn muốn làm việc với.

// Step 1: Load the PSD File
string inputFilePath = "input.psd";
using (Image image = (Image)Image.Load(inputFilePath))
{
    // Further processing will go here
}

Bước 2: Thực hiện điều chỉnh cân bằng màu

Một khi tệp PSD được tải lên, bạn có thể áp dụng các điều chỉnh cân bằng màu bằng cách truy cập vào các thuộc tính của hình ảnh và sửa đổi các cài đặt cân nặng màu sắc. bước này liên quan đến việc xác định số lượng màu đỏ, xanh và xanh để thêm hoặc rút ra từ các bóng, giữa, và điểm nổi bật của ảnh.

// Step 2: Apply Color Balance Adjustments
PsdImage psdImage = (PsdImage)Image.Load(inputFilePath);
psdImage.AdjustColorBalance(new ColorBalanceOptions
{
    Red = new[] { -10, 0, 10 }, // Shadows, Midtones, Highlights for Red
    Green = new[] { -5, 0, 5 }, // Shadows, Midtones, Highlights for Green
    Blue = new[] { 0, 10, -10 } // Shadows, Midtones, Highlights for Blue
});

Bước 3: Lưu tệp PSD được sửa đổi

Sau khi áp dụng các điều chỉnh cân bằng màu mong muốn, điều quan trọng là lưu lại tệp PSD được sửa đổi trở lại ổ đĩa. Điều này đảm bảo rằng bất kỳ thay đổi nào được thực hiện sẽ được giữ lại cho việc sử dụng hoặc phân phối trong tương lai.

// Step 3: Save the Modified PSD File
string outputFilePath = "output.psd";
using (PsdImage psdImage = (PsdImage)Image.Load(inputFilePath))
{
    // Apply color balance adjustments here...

    // Save the modified PSD file to disk
    psdImage.Save(outputFilePath);
}

Thực hành tốt nhất

Tự động hóa sự cân bằng màu sắc trong các tập tin PSD bằng cách sử dụng Aspose.PSD cho .NET không chỉ tiết kiệm thời gian mà còn đảm bảo sự nhất quán trên một số lượng lớn hình ảnh.Bằng cách làm theo các bước được mô tả trong hướng dẫn này, các nhà phát triển có thể dễ dàng tích hợp các khả năng xử lý ảnh tiên tiến vào ứng dụng của họ, tăng cường chất lượng tổng thể và hiệu quả của dòng công việc.

Khi làm việc với điều chỉnh cân bằng màu sắc, điều quan trọng là phải thử nghiệm với các cài đặt khác nhau để tìm cân đối tối ưu cho trường hợp sử dụng cụ thể của bạn. Ngoài ra, xem xét việc thực hiện các kiểm tra xử lý lỗi và xác thực để đảm bảo rằng các tập tin PSD được xử lí đúng và hiệu quả.

Bằng cách tận dụng các tính năng mạnh mẽ của Aspose.PSD, các nhà phát triển có thể đơn giản hóa các nhiệm vụ xử lý hình ảnh của họ và cung cấp kết quả chất lượng cao với nỗ lực tối thiểu.

More in this category